[devel] mkimage broke too | was: kernel-image girar install check vs make-initrd

Michael Shigorin mike на osdn.org.ua
Вт Дек 14 15:40:13 UTC 2010


On Tue, Dec 14, 2010 at 06:07:26PM +0300, Anton Farygin wrote:
> >вот так всё-таки шибко хакообразно:
> >http://git.altlinux.org/people/boyarsh/packages/?p=mkimage-profiles-desktop.git;a=blob;f=profiles/scripts.d/80-make-initfs;h=5980f53f7442972c0858f648a4a4265ea562e44b;hb=75a8e8516cd26b955e34357dc3fef01155d6bb4a
> Исправлено в гите уже.

Если ты про "workaround for mkimage kernel detection algoritm":

http://git.altlinux.org/people/rider/packages/?p=mkimage-profiles-desktop.git;a=commitdiff;h=97a87063af6a11b3541594500082a2821626f946

-- то всё-таки лучше бы в mkimage исправлять (legion@ в курсе).

Где-то так:

---
if [ -L /boot/vmlinuz ]; then
        kimage="\$(readlink -ev /boot/vmlinuz)"
else
        kimage="\$(find /boot -type f -name 'vmlinuz-*' | head -1)"
fi
kver="\${kimage#/boot/vmlinuz-}"
---

-- 
 ---- WBR, Michael Shigorin <mike на altlinux.ru>
  ------ Linux.Kiev http://www.linux.kiev.ua/


Подробная информация о списке рассылки Devel